Job title: Senior Administrative Assistant in San Antonio, TX at Aleknagik Technology


Company: Aleknagik Technology


Job description: Aleknagik Technology, LLC is searching for a qualified candidate to fill the role of Senior Administrative Assistant to support the Total Health Analytics Nodal Operations Support (THANOS) III. This individual will manage schedule, coordinate meetings, track documentation and support the daily functions of leadership and program staff. The role requires strong organizational skills, attention to detail, and the ability to work efficiently in a dynamic, fast-paced environment. The position will be onsite at Falls Church, VA or San Antonio, TX, with remote work options as approved.Duties:
  • Provide administrative support to program leadership and senior staff.
  • Manage calendars, schedule meetings, and coordinate travel and logistics.
  • Prepare, proofread, and distribute correspondence, reports, and presentations.
  • Maintain organized filing systems and manage document tracking and archiving.
  • Support program events, workshops, and virtual engagements, including setting up virtual meeting tools.
  • Assist with the onboarding of new staff, including coordination of equipment and access.
  • Track deadlines, deliverables, and correspondence to ensure timely completion of tasks.
  • Handle confidential information with discretion and always maintain professional decorum.
Qualifications:
  • High school diploma or equivalent; associate or bachelor's degree preferred.
  • 5+ years of administrative experience, including experience supporting executive-level staff.
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ite (Word, Excel, PowerPoint, Outlook) and virtual meeting platforms (e.g., Zoom, MS Teams, WebEx).
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ills.
  • Exceptional organizational and time-management abilities.
  • Ability to handle sensitive and confidential information appropriately
  • Experience supporting federal government programs or healthcare projects.
  • Knowledge of government procurement, records management, or administrative procedures.
  • Ability to adapt quickly to shifting priorities and maintain composure under pressure.
  • US Citizen
  • Hold a Secret Clearance
